Distribution of Persistent Currents in a Multi-Arm Mesoscopic Ring: A Theoretical Study

Santanu K. Maiti, Srilekha Saha, Samit Karmakar

Open full text 0 citations

Abstract

We propose an idea to investigate persistent current in individual arms of a multi-arm mesoscopic ring. Following a brief description of persistent current in a traditional mesoscopic ring pierced by an Aharonov-Bohm (AB) flux $\phi$, we examine the behavior of persistent currents in separate arms of a three-arm mesoscopic ring where upper and lower sub-rings are subject to AB fluxes $\phi_1$ and $\phi_2$, respectively. The present analysis may provide a basic framework to study magnetic response in individual branches of any complicated quantum network.
